Artikel ini menjelaskan cara menjadwalkan boot ulang di sistem operasi Ubuntu®.
Jadwalkan reboot dengan menggunakan crontab
Misalkan Anda ingin me-reboot server pada pukul 02:05 setiap hari. Lakukan langkah-langkah berikut, sesuaikan detail agar sesuai dengan kebutuhan Anda:
-
Gunakan perintah berikut untuk mengedit file crontab:
$ sudo crontab -e
-
Untuk masuk ke mode sisipkan dan tambahkan baris baru di akhir file, pindahkan kursor ke baris terakhir dan tekan huruf o .
-
Di baris kosong, tambahkan baris berikut ke file untuk mengatur waktu eksekusi harian yang diinginkan dan perintah untuk dieksekusi:
05 02 * * * /sbin/shutdown -r +5
-
Tekan Esc untuk keluar dari mode penyisipan lalu masuk ke :wq untuk menyimpan file dan keluar dari
crontab
.
Crontab
contoh:
Contoh berikut menunjukkan kemungkinan nilai untuk setiap elemen garis di crontab
.
# Example of job definition:
# .---------------- minute (0 - 59)
# | .------------- hour (0 - 23)
# | | .---------- day of month (1 - 31)
# | | | .------- month (1 - 12) OR jan,feb,mar,apr ...
# | | | | .---- day of week (0 - 6) (Sunday=0, Monday=1, and so on)
# | | | | |
# * * * * * user-name command-to-be-executed
Catatan: Mem-boot ulang server Anda secara berkala mungkin merupakan perbaikan sementara. Pecahkan masalah sebenarnya alih-alih mengandalkan boot ulang server untuk menutupi masalah.